Output e14f283c7640360241d2f8acaf902d539c84cfc7e4baba3a6f67f6ba5abefe3b:1

value
584463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ae322294946217b7e1dea31858287249ff7a3dc OP_EQUAL
address
349Bb3FTQmMLswz6v1hHFf394bEPwGUno6
transaction
e14f283c7640360241d2f8acaf902d539c84cfc7e4baba3a6f67f6ba5abefe3b
spent
true